The Brass Door, formerly known as the 8/5 Club, was established by Howard Schlesinger in 1946. It was originally a six-stool bar and 20-person dining facility with a menu, which comprised of steam beer and fried chicken. Schlesinger s son, Mickey and his partner Dick Basso bought the club in 1955. Soon after, they renamed the club, The Brass Door. Over the years, the partners expanded the facility to include a 20-stool bar, 50-seater cocktail lounge and a dining area for 160 guests. Following a brief period of closure in 1994, due to a fire, the bar was completely rebuilt. Still operational from its original location in San Ramon, Calif., the bar has an extensive menu of prime beef, fresh seafood, salads and pastas.
